Abstract
In this paper, we study the localization and propagation properties of the edge states associated to a class of magnetic laplacians in . We assume that the intensity of the magnetic field has a fast transition along a regular and compact curve . Our main results extend to a general regular curve the study of the localised eigenfunction obtained when is a straight line (i.e. Iwatsuka models). Furthermore, we include in our analysis the case of magnetic fields that slowly change along the curve and we obtain a rigorous and explicit characterization of the asymptotic mass distribution of the edge state along .
